Syringes and needles market in India is expected to grow at a CAGR of 15% representing in huge opportunities in this sector, finds a new research report launched by NOVONOUS. This growth is driven by India’s large pool of patients, increasing healthcare expenditure, increasing healthcare awareness and rising government spending.

Syringes and needles market in India is dominated by disposable syringes and needles followed by AD syringes and needles, reusable syringes and needles and other syringes and needles (pre-filled, insulin etc.) based on the total revenue generated.

Disposable syringes currently control the largest market share in terms of revenue in Indian syringes and needles market. As per NOVONOUS estimates, Indian disposable syringes market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 15% till 2020 and maintain its market share position even in 2020.

Auto Disable (AD)/ safety syringes and needles currently control the second largest market share in terms of revenue in Indian market. As per NOVONOUS estimates, Indian Auto Disable (AD)/ safety syringes and needles market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 19% till 2020 and maintain its market share position.

Reusable syringes and needles in Indian syringes and needles market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 5% till 2020.

Other (pre-filled, insulin etc.) syringes and needles in Indian syringes and needles market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 9% till 2020.

EXIM Scenario in Indian Syringes and Needles Market
- India exported US$ 35.22 million worth of syringes and the overall exported quantity was 719.48 million units in FY 2014-15. Brazil, Nigeria, Malaysia, Tanzania and South Korea were the top five nations importing Indian syringes in 2014-15.
- India imported US$ 29.87 million worth of syringes and the overall imported quantity was 783.14 million units in FY 2014-15. USA, Singapore, Spain, Mexico and France were the top five nations exporting syringes to India in 2014-15.
- India exported US$ 0.49 million worth of tubular metal needles and the overall exported quantity was 41.28 thousand kgs. in FY 2014-15. Argentina, Sri Lanka, France, Singapore and Australia were the top five nations importing Indian tubular metal needles in 2014-15.
- India imported US$ 15.06 million worth of tubular metal needles and the overall imported quantity was 467.91 thousand kgs.in FY 2014-15. Singapore, Belgium, Australia, Japan and USA were the top five nations exporting tubular metal needles to India in 2014-15.
- India exported US$ 4.95 million worth of cardiac catheters and the overall exported quantity was 31.76 million units in FY 2014-15. Belgium, Brazil, Bangladesh, Malaysia and Italy were the top five nations importing Indian cardiac catheters in 2014-15.
- India imported US$ 37.65 million worth of cardiac catheters and the overall imported quantity was 1.38 million units in FY 2014-15. USA, Ireland, Japan, Germany and Mexico were the top five nations exporting cardiac catheters to India in 2014-15.
- India exported US$ 76.97 million worth of cannulae and the overall exported quantity was 834.32 million units in FY 2014-15. Brazil, Turkey, Egypt, Germany and Iran were the top five nations importing Indian cannulae in 2014-15.
- India imported US$ 26.20 million worth of cannulae and the overall imported quantity was 785.70 million units in FY 2014-15. Singapore, USA, Spain, China and Malaysia were the top five nations exporting cannulae to India in 2014-15.
